Lakeland Panthers repeat as Edmonton Invitiation Bantam Hockey Tournament champs
The Lakeland Panthers repeated as one of the best in Alberta bantam hockey over the Christmas holidays.
The Panthers won their second straight Edmonton Invitation Bantam Hockey Tournament with a 6-1 victory over the Olds Grizzlys after scoring five unanswered goals in the first period.
The team remains undefeated (22-0) in league play.
The tournament began on Dec. 27 with a 3-2 win over the Calgary Canucks and a 9-1 route of the Parkland Athletic Club White the following day.
After beating the South Side Athletic Club Pro Hockey Life 6-1, the Panthers punched their ticket to the semi-final.
The Panthers met the Maple Leaf Athletic Club Alumni and crushed them 7-3 setting up the final against the Grizzlys, the south’s top ranked team.
The Lakeland Panthers play the Peace River Sabres on Saturday in Bonnyville at 4:15pm.
